Latest Social Media Service for Event Organisers

Event organisers that understand how to harness the power of social networking are benefitting from increased registration and are also building a community with which they can access all year round

Key Features

Key Features at http://event-master.com/social_media_overview.html

Branding - The look and feel of your organisation including logo, colour scheme, layout and more

Delegate Profiles - A quick snapshot of personal data that will assist the delegates in sharing/connecting with other delegates/speakers/sponsors etc more efficiently while allowing the organisers to more effectively gauge their connected audience

Networking - Allows the delegate or sponsor/brand to quickly build a network of "friends" who are participating in the same event or group

Messaging - Participants can Direct Message (Private), Instant Message, Post Message (Public) all in their network

Groups - Form or join niche groups who share the same interest. Groups will have members/sponsors whose opinions and ideas are meaningful to you

Email + Phone Support – Delegates can utilize their mobile devices to connect and distribute information. Fully functioning next-gen phone integration

Site Admin – We will host your community, taking the worry away and giving you what you need without the hassle of hosting yourself

Outbound Emails - Send email directly from your "social media service" interface. You do not have to log out or log into another site (gmail, Yahoo) keeping your delegates` focus on your message and your sponsors

Outbound Twitter – Send "Tweets' (Twitter messages) directly from your "social media service" interface. This ease of use keeps engaged eyes on your message and on your pages

Topic Crowdsourcing - A problem-solving tool that allows delegates/sponsors to post questions/challenges that engages the entire community and elicits responses from the crowd. A great way for sponsors to engage delegates

Event Calendar - Allows users to track, map, set reminders and organise countless sub-events taking place at your event

iCal/Outlook Sync - One click export of your entire calendar to various popular calendar tools, gCal, iCal and Outlook

Event Feedback - An aggregator that tracks/compiles, mentions, blogs, posts about the event and the sponsors alike. Invaluable tool to offer sponsors a way of creating real time feedback on their performance at your event

Product Fan Pages - Sponsors/brands can create "Fan Pages" that allow members to exclusively follow and participate in all activities surrounding a particular brand/sponsor

Outbound RSS - Send blog posts and other simple syndication messages directly from your "social media service" site to keep attention on your and your sponsors message

Blog Ingest - Users/sponsors can sync their blogs or blogs they subscribe to, to their "social media service" homepage easily allowing them to share their information to the focused and engaged audience at your event

Twitter Ingest - Users/sponsors can receive inbound Twitter updates directly from "the social media service" interface. More eyes on your material at all times means greater ROI for all

Flickr Ingest - Users/sponsors can receive and share inbound pictures and messages from the popular social site Flickr without having to leave their "social media service" homepage

YouTube Ingest - Users/sponsors can receive and share videos originating from the ever-popular YouTube without having to leave your specially branded site

Search - Allows all delegates to quickly and easily find relevant and real time information regarding the topic they are searching

Site Analytics - Powerful analysis tools providing meaningful reports on everything from delegate participation, to trends, to registrations and more. A tremendous tool to show sponsors why your event is attractive to them

Facebook Friend Match - Identifies a Facebook friend that is also attending the event. Naturally, those who know each other outside of your event would love to know who in their "circle" is also in the crowd

Facebook Newsfeed Posting - Users can post seamlessly to Facebook, including articles, voting, blogs and more that will be spread virally. Helps create greater buzz about your event

Twitter Friend Match - Identifies a Twitter "follower" that is also attending the event. Many people keep very different Facebook and Twitter "lives" so it is important to cater to both

Gmail Friend Match - Identifies a Gmail "contact" that is also attending the event. Though popular, many are still not engaged in the world of Twitter or Facebook

LinkedIn Friend Match - Identifies a LinkedIn "connection" that is also attending the event

Delegate Database Integration - We will either integrate with REGIS or our delegate module
